AccessTr.neT
İskonto Hesaplama - Baskı Önizleme

+- AccessTr.neT (https://accesstr.net)
+-- Forum: AccessTr.neT Genel (https://accesstr.net/forum-accesstr-net-genel.html)
+--- Forum: Çöp Kutusu (https://accesstr.net/forum-cop-kutusu.html)
+--- Konu Başlığı: İskonto Hesaplama (/konu-iskonto-hesaplama.html)



İskonto Hesaplama - U.ALTUN - 16/06/2025

Merhaba Arkadaşlar alış fatura adlı formunda Dip İskonto Tutar, Dip İskonto Tutar diye iki iskonto yerimiz var tutar kısmından girilen tutar alt toplamda düşülerek yüzdesi metin kutusuna hesaplamadan çıkan yüzdesi gelecek yaptığım işlemde bir hata var yüzdeler alakasız olarak geliyor kontrol etmenizi rica edeceğim. form ekte yüklemiştir.


RE: İskonto Hesaplama - atoykan - 17/06/2025

Yapmak istediğiniz işlemi daha detaylı anlatır mısınız? Zira mantık olarak anlamadığım ve açıkçası işin özüne de pek uyduramadığım detaylar var. Örneğin
Me.Altisktoplam = Val(Nz(Me.xiskonto)) + Val(Nz(Me.yuzde))
kodu tuhaf.
xiskonto zaten toplamdan düşülen net bir tutar olarak belirlenmiş, yuzde ise toplamın yüzde kaçının indirildiğini ifade eden bir oran olmalı tanımlamanız da genel uygulamada bu yönde ancak siz net bir tutar ile oranı toplamaya çalışıyorsunuz mantık olarak hatalı. Ayrıca NZ kullanımında da mantık hatası yapıyorsunuz. NZ fonksiyonu ikinci bir parametre almalıdır yani Null olduğunda ne kullanılsın diye sorar. Siz bu değeri 0 olarak tanımlamazsanız sizin kullandığınız hali ile Null değeri için boş string ("") döndürür. Val("") değeri 0 döndürsede güvenilir değildir değişkenler string formatı ise vb durumlarda bazen beklenmedik sonuçlar verebilir. Sayısal işlemler için verilerinizi sayısal olarak tanımlamalısınız. String verilerden dönüşüm formülleri ile sayısal geçişler yapılabilmekteyse de sağlıklı bir yaklaşım değil.


RE: İskonto Hesaplama - U.ALTUN - 17/06/2025

yapmak istediğim olayı görselini de yüklüyorum faturada alt toplamdan düşülecek iskonto 2 seçenek halinde fatura formu üzerinde işlem görülecek işlemler fatura detayında görünecek anlatabilmişimdir.


RE: İskonto Hesaplama - atoykan - 22/06/2025

Açıkçası çalışmanızdan zerre bir şey anlamadım. Sekme kontrolü kullanmışsınız satır kısmına giriş yapmadan fatura bilgisi gelmiyor, satır bilgisinde iskonto girişi yapılmadan fatura sekmesine bilgi gelmiyor, iskonto girişini satır bilgisinde yapıyorsanız ve toplam iskonto olarak gösteriyorsanız dip iskonto tutar ve yüzdesine ne gerek var ilgilii alanlara satır bilgisindeki girişlerinizi getirin. Yapmak istediğiizi açıklayın dedim resim üzerine notlar yazıp göndermişsiniz. Sorularınızı bulmaca çözer gibi buraya ne yapınca ne oluyor diye dene yanıl inceleme şansımız / vaktimiz yok.